Transaction 193dcf684f655edef2ce8d1e6079e56a8e09ffa20db5c81a961194a07de47693

1 Input
2 Outputs
  • 193dcf684f655edef2ce8d1e6079e56a8e09ffa20db5c81a961194a07de47693:0
  • value  3291585
    address  3QakxdVckvR2aREsdHoAYXVmBAWdm1o7BZ
  • 193dcf684f655edef2ce8d1e6079e56a8e09ffa20db5c81a961194a07de47693:1
  • value  12129496
    address  34ubeCumxaZmf7YDTibeBhMWX1qWkD39nB